中国广东某三级医院普通医学专业本科生对研究参与的认知、态度及障碍

Perceptions, attitudes, and barriers to research engagement among general medicine undergraduates in a tertiary hospital in Guangdong, China.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

Research is a critical component of medical education, fostering critical thinking and evidence-based practice. However, in China, particularly in the context of general practice, undergraduate medical students often face significant barriers to engaging in research. This study aims to assess the perception, attitude, and practice toward research among undergraduate medical students in a tertiary hospital in Guangdong, China, and to identify the barriers they face.

METHODS

A cross-sectional study was conducted among 90 undergraduate medical students from a tertiary hospital in Guangdong, China, from May to June 2024. A self-administered questionnaire was used to collect data on students' perception, attitudes, practices, and perceived barriers toward research.

RESULTS

The majority of students (46.6%) expressed a strong desire to pursue postgraduate studies, while only 25.5% showed a strong interest in participating in research. Key barriers included lack of time (65.5%), insufficient research guidance (56.6%), and limited access to resources (47.8%). Students' self-assessment of their research abilities was generally low, with only 9.5% feeling confident in their ability to handle data. Positive correlations were found between access to research guidance and interest in scientific literature (r = 0.62, P < 0.001).

CONCLUSION

This study identifies key areas for improving research training among undergraduate medical students, particularly in general practice programs. It suggests that standardized curricula, enhanced mentorship, and hospital-university research platforms may help address existing gaps. Given the study's limited sample and setting, further research is needed to confirm these findings in broader contexts.

CLINICAL TRIAL NUMBER

Not applicable.

摘要

背景

研究是医学教育的关键组成部分,有助于培养批判性思维和循证医学实践。然而,在中国,尤其是在全科医学背景下,本科医学生在参与研究时往往面临重大障碍。本研究旨在评估中国广东某三甲医院本科医学生对研究的认知、态度和实践情况,并确定他们面临的障碍。

方法

2024年5月至6月,对中国广东某三甲医院的90名本科医学生进行了一项横断面研究。采用自填式问卷收集学生对研究的认知、态度、实践情况以及感知到的障碍等数据。

结果

大多数学生(46.6%)表示强烈希望攻读研究生学位,而只有25.5%的学生对参与研究表现出浓厚兴趣。主要障碍包括时间不足(65.5%)、研究指导不足(56.6%)和资源获取有限(47.8%)。学生对自己研究能力的自我评估普遍较低,只有9.5%的学生对自己处理数据的能力有信心。研究指导的获取与对科学文献的兴趣之间存在正相关(r = 0.62,P < 0.001)。

结论

本研究确定了本科医学生,特别是全科医学专业学生在研究培训方面需要改进的关键领域。研究表明,标准化课程、加强指导以及医院-大学研究平台可能有助于弥补现有差距。鉴于本研究样本和研究背景有限,需要进一步研究在更广泛的背景下证实这些发现。

临床试验编号

不适用。
